Fittingly, “Summer Eternal” doesn’t aim to “outdo or even surpass” the original “Disco Elysium,” as it’s more focused on artistic vision than profit

How do you continue your work on Disco Elysium without simply making something too similar to Disco Elysium to be as innovative as Disco Elysium? It’s a hell of a mystery and also something that Summer Eternal, the new studio with former ZA/UM developers who had their own manifesto, is grappling with.

That, of course, was one of the things I told studio staff Argo Tuulik, Dora Klindžić and Aleksandar Gavrilović about when I spoke to them about Summer Eternal in an interview, the main part of which you can read here and in the next day or so You can find out more about this on this website.

“Comparisons and expectations are inevitable,” Klindíić said of the studio’s approach to the game it will make: “But the origin of our work will be our current conditions, our current team, our current reality, not the past that will never be recaptured and is a stupid task.”

“Ultimately, as we develop and design this game from the ground up, we will only evaluate each element based on whether it lives up to what we as a team want to achieve today. Of course men do, as the great man’s quote goes. “We do not shape their history as we please, so our present will always be shaped by our past. But we want to shed all unnecessary ballast and concentrate on building the future.

“We approach this process with no intention of ‘exceeding’ or even ‘equaling’ Elysium, or of competing with any other company on Earth or in orbit, nor of claiming commercial success. We will leave this business to the profiteers. “We will work like artists, that is, with both eyes on the work, not one on the audience and not one on the competition.”

Gavrilovic, on the other hand, described himself as the very greatest builder of communism in his assessment of the task before us: “When Lenin wrote about how best to climb a high mountain, he outlined an important aspect: the climb when one is already on it Located at a high vantage point, sometimes you have to take a different route and descend. This descent is often more dangerous and is always accompanied by the evil gloating of those who, above all, wish that you do not succeed. But if we want to achieve our ambitious plan, we must take our time and descend the mountain first before climbing an even higher peak, no matter how long it takes.”

Summer Eternal isn’t the only new studio to see former ZA/UM developers take on this sort of task with a new game – Longdue and Dark Math Games, announced in the same week earlier this month, need to figure out how they want to step up Lenin’s mountain.
